These columns are made of mix of polymers like polysaccharides and silica which act as the key type of adsorbent used in measurement exclusion HPLC. The HPLC columns tend not to get more info reply on interaction While using the analyte elements but alternatively utilize sieving outcome depending on molecular bodyweight of your analyte components. The packing of such columns have the two micropores and mesopores the place the dimensions distribution of these pores determines the size of your molecules in the sample that could diffuse in to the pores.

A general rule to remember is the fact that as the column temperature increases, analyte retention decreases, bringing about a lot quicker separation.

Gradient separations usually present excellent overall performance in excess of isocratic modes but tend to be more complex and involve Innovative pump hardware.
